General annotation (Comments)
| Function | This enzyme hydrolyzes cefotaxime, ceftazidime and other broad spectrum cephalosporins. |
| Catalytic activity | A beta-lactam + H2O = a substituted beta-amino acid. |
| Sequence similarities | Belongs to the class-A beta-lactamase family. |
